Said by Capt. Louis Renault in the 1942 film Casablanca, immediately prior to receiving his cut of the gambling.

Phrase

[edit]

I'm shocked, shocked, to find that gambling is going on in here

  1. (politics, sports) Said in reference to the hypocrisy of officials who are supposed to police illicit activities but engage in those activities themselves.
